Strawn, Livingston County, Illinois Property Taxes
Median Strawn, IL effective property tax rate: 2.94%, significantly higher than the national median of 1.02%, but lower than the Illinois state median of 2.35%.
Median Strawn, IL home value: $179,874
Median annual Strawn, IL tax bill: $6,491, $4,091 higher than the national median property tax bill of $2,400.

Property Tax Rates Across Strawn, Livingston County, Illinois
Local government entities set tax rates, which can vary widely within a state. This variation is because annually, each county estimates its required budget to provide services and divides that by the total value of all taxable property within its jurisdiction. This calculation results in the property tax rate. While there are votes and laws involved in setting tax rates and budgets, in a nutshell, this is the annual process. Property Tax Assessment Values Across Strawn, Livingston County, Illinois
When examining property taxes in Strawn, IL, understanding the distinction between "market value" and "assessed value" is crucial. The market value is what a willing buyer would pay to a willing seller in an open and competitive market, often influenced by location, property condition, and economic market trends. The Livingston County Assessor estimates the market value for tax purposes. The assessed value is the market value minus any applicable exemptions or limits determined by local laws and offerings. The tax assessed value is the figure used to calculate your property taxes or the amount multiplied by your tax rate to get your tax bill.
Assessment notices:
In Livingston County, assessment notices are sent in the spring each year. They’ll typically reach your mailbox by the middle of May. Each property owner receives an assessment notice that contains both the market value and assessed value, along with an estimate of your property tax bill. Property Tax Bills Across Strawn, Livingston County, Illinois
In Strawn, property tax bills are determined by the assessed value of a home, which is calculated as a percentage of its market value. The tax rate, set by local taxing authorities in Livingston County, is then applied to this assessed value to determine the annual tax bill. Homeowners in Strawn typically face a median property tax bill of $6,491, which is significantly higher than the national median of $2,400.
